Skip to content

0.3.0

Compare
Choose a tag to compare
@doddgu doddgu released this 25 Feb 02:10
· 678 commits to main since this release
80847ea
0.3.0 (#13)

* chore: update readme

* Merge branch 'docs/contrib' of...

* fix: Fix the problem of failing to get context after enabling soft delete

* Configuration and UnitTest

* chore: support net6.0

* Doc/contrib

* Feature/optimize

* chore: add package CI

* chore: update library package

* chore: add Codecov

* chore: update codecov

* chore: update codecov

* docs: add codecov badge

* chore: codecov ignore tests

* chore: update codecov

* chore: update codecov

* Update packge.yml

* Feature/ci

* 🆕 feat(minimal-apis): Improve MapGet, MapPost, MapPut and MapDelete with BaseUri prop

* 🐛 fix: Combine baseUri and customUri

* Update .gitlab-ci.yml

* 更新.gitlab-ci.yml文件

* Delete .gitlab-ci.yml

* chore: change fileName

* chore: update dapr library package

* chore: change readme

* chore: Added a solution to the failure to obtain the Event relationship chain

* Fix/event

* add ghpackageconfig

* Update package_push_github.yml

* Update package_push_nuget.org.yml

* Update nuget.config

* Update nuget.config

* Update package_push_nuget.org.yml

* Update package_push_github.yml

* Update nuget.config

* chore: Modify the introduction of Uow usage documentation (#3)

* chore: Modify the introduction of Uow usage documentation

* chore: Remove invalid comments

* Update package_push_github.yml

* Update nuget.config

* feat:event bus

* chore: Support local message retry

* chore: add retry record

* chore: Change the current time to Utc time

* chore: Optimize background tasks

* chore: Increase local message retry

* chore: Add local queue to support short retry

* chore: add retry retry Policy Documentation

* chore: Upgrade the base library

* chore: 1. Adjust EventBus to automatically execute savechange

          2. UoW supports Dispose
          3. Simplify the writing of Event, Command, Query, IntegrationEvent, etc.

* chore: Open transactions are controlled by Repository

* chore: adjust UnitOfWork and localmessage

* chore: add EventBus doc

* chore: Add local message table log

* chore: Adjust retry configuration

* chore: code review modification

* chore: Get current time support modification

* chore: Change the file name ConfigurationAPIClient -> ConfigurationApiClient

* chore: Change the file name ConfigurationAPIClient -> ConfigurationApiClient

Change the file name ConfigurationAPIManage -> ConfigurationApiManage
EntityState overload

* chore: Change the file name ConfigurationAPIClient -> ConfigurationApiClient

Change the file name ConfigurationAPIManage -> ConfigurationApiManage
EntityState overload

* chore: Update MASA.BuildingBlocks.DDD.Domain package version

* chore: add JsonIgnore and adjust unittest

* chore: code review modification

* chore: Adjust the writing method of CheckAndOpenTransaction to simplify nested if

* chore: Change the parameter description, change Task.Delay to Thread.Sleep

* fix: Fixed an error in the PublishQueueAsync method in the IDomainEventBus

* fix: Fixed an error in the PublishQueueAsync method in the IDomainEventBus class

* chore: remove using by class

* Squashed 'src/MASA.BuildingBlocks/' content from commit b6a2d36

git-subtree-dir: src/MASA.BuildingBlocks
git-subtree-split: b6a2d366dae89cef24d452ae2ad4d4debe252ae6

* update src

* add buildingblock

* update action

* Delete package_push_github.yml

* Update package_push_nuget.org.yml

* refactor: project references building blocks

* chore: Support local message retry

* chore: add retry record

* chore: Change the current time to Utc time

* chore: Optimize background tasks

* chore: Increase local message retry

* chore: Add local queue to support short retry

* chore: add retry retry Policy Documentation

* chore: Upgrade the base library

* chore: 1. Adjust EventBus to automatically execute savechange

          2. UoW supports Dispose
          3. Simplify the writing of Event, Command, Query, IntegrationEvent, etc.

* chore: Open transactions are controlled by Repository

* chore: adjust UnitOfWork and localmessage

* chore: add EventBus doc

* chore: Add local message table log

* chore: Adjust retry configuration

* chore: code review modification

* chore: Get current time support modification

* chore: Change the file name ConfigurationAPIClient -> ConfigurationApiClient

* chore: Change the file name ConfigurationAPIClient -> ConfigurationApiClient

Change the file name ConfigurationAPIManage -> ConfigurationApiManage
EntityState overload

* chore: Change the file name ConfigurationAPIClient -> ConfigurationApiClient

Change the file name ConfigurationAPIManage -> ConfigurationApiManage
EntityState overload

* chore: Update MASA.BuildingBlocks.DDD.Domain package version

* chore: add JsonIgnore and adjust unittest

* chore: code review modification

* chore: Adjust the writing method of CheckAndOpenTransaction to simplify nested if

* chore: Change the parameter description, change Task.Delay to Thread.Sleep

* Update package_push_github.yml

* chore: update library package and filter the local failure message just executed

* chore: update library package

* Update package_push_github.yml

* Update package_push_github.yml

* chore: ILogger changed to optional

* chore: add Logging by integrationEventBus

* chore: Handle background local message tasks

* refactor: Handling null exceptions, warnings, and Logger changed to not requiredHandling null exceptions, warnings, and Logger changed to not required

* chore: update library package

* chore: adjust DelayAsync

* chore: Replacement interval in seconds

* chore: delete summodule

* chore: add MASA.BuildingBlocks submodules

* chore: Change parameter remarks

* chore: Adjust package references

* chore: remove MASA.BuildingBlock package

* Update package_push_nuget.org.yml

* Update package_push_nuget.org.yml

* refactor: change MASA.Contrib to Masa.Contrib (#11)

* tag: 0.3.0-preview.1 (#10)

* chore: update readme

* Merge branch 'docs/contrib' of...

* fix: Fix the problem of failing to get context after enabling soft delete

* Configuration and UnitTest

* chore: support net6.0

* Doc/contrib

* Feature/optimize

* chore: add package CI

* chore: update library package

* chore: add Codecov

* chore: update codecov

* chore: update codecov

* docs: add codecov badge

* chore: codecov ignore tests

* chore: update codecov

* chore: update codecov

* Update packge.yml

* Feature/ci

* 🆕 feat(minimal-apis): Improve MapGet, MapPost, MapPut and MapDelete with BaseUri prop

* 🐛 fix: Combine baseUri and customUri

* Update .gitlab-ci.yml

* 更新.gitlab-ci.yml文件

* Delete .gitlab-ci.yml

* chore: change fileName

* chore: update dapr library package

* chore: change readme

* chore: Added a solution to the failure to obtain the Event relationship chain

* Fix/event

* add ghpackageconfig

* Update package_push_github.yml

* Update package_push_nuget.org.yml

* Update nuget.config

* Update nuget.config

* Update package_push_nuget.org.yml

* Update package_push_github.yml

* Update nuget.config

* chore: Modify the introduction of Uow usage documentation (#3)

* chore: Modify the introduction of Uow usage documentation

* chore: Remove invalid comments

* Update package_push_github.yml

* Update nuget.config

* feat:event bus

* chore: Support local message retry

* chore: add retry record

* chore: Change the current time to Utc time

* chore: Optimize background tasks

* chore: Increase local message retry

* chore: Add local queue to support short retry

* chore: add retry retry Policy Documentation

* chore: Upgrade the base library

* chore: 1. Adjust EventBus to automatically execute savechange

          2. UoW supports Dispose
          3. Simplify the writing of Event, Command, Query, IntegrationEvent, etc.

* chore: Open transactions are controlled by Repository

* chore: adjust UnitOfWork and localmessage

* chore: add EventBus doc

* chore: Add local message table log

* chore: Adjust retry configuration

* chore: code review modification

* chore: Get current time support modification

* chore: Change the file name ConfigurationAPIClient -> ConfigurationApiClient

* chore: Change the file name ConfigurationAPIClient -> ConfigurationApiClient

Change the file name ConfigurationAPIManage -> ConfigurationApiManage
EntityState overload

* chore: Change the file name ConfigurationAPIClient -> ConfigurationApiClient

Change the file name ConfigurationAPIManage -> ConfigurationApiManage
EntityState overload

* chore: Update MASA.BuildingBlocks.DDD.Domain package version

* chore: add JsonIgnore and adjust unittest

* chore: code review modification

* chore: Adjust the writing method of CheckAndOpenTransaction to simplify nested if

* chore: Change the parameter description, change Task.Delay to Thread.Sleep

* fix: Fixed an error in the PublishQueueAsync method in the IDomainEventBus

* fix: Fixed an error in the PublishQueueAsync method in the IDomainEventBus class

* chore: remove using by class

* Squashed 'src/MASA.BuildingBlocks/' content from commit b6a2d36

git-subtree-dir: src/MASA.BuildingBlocks
git-subtree-split: b6a2d366dae89cef24d452ae2ad4d4debe252ae6

* update src

* add buildingblock

* update action

* Delete package_push_github.yml

* Update package_push_nuget.org.yml

* refactor: project references building blocks

* chore: Support local message retry

* chore: add retry record

* chore: Change the current time to Utc time

* chore: Optimize background tasks

* chore: Increase local message retry

* chore: Add local queue to support short retry

* chore: add retry retry Policy Documentation

* chore: Upgrade the base library

* chore: 1. Adjust EventBus to automatically execute savechange

          2. UoW supports Dispose
          3. Simplify the writing of Event, Command, Query, IntegrationEvent, etc.

* chore: Open transactions are controlled by Repository

* chore: adjust UnitOfWork and localmessage

* chore: add EventBus doc

* chore: Add local message table log

* chore: Adjust retry configuration

* chore: code review modification

* chore: Get current time support modification

* chore: Change the file name ConfigurationAPIClient -> ConfigurationApiClient

* chore: Change the file name ConfigurationAPIClient -> ConfigurationApiClient

Change the file name ConfigurationAPIManage -> ConfigurationApiManage
EntityState overload

* chore: Change the file name ConfigurationAPIClient -> ConfigurationApiClient

Change the file name ConfigurationAPIManage -> ConfigurationApiManage
EntityState overload

* chore: Update MASA.BuildingBlocks.DDD.Domain package version

* chore: add JsonIgnore and adjust unittest

* chore: code review modification

* chore: Adjust the writing method of CheckAndOpenTransaction to simplify nested if

* chore: Change the parameter description, change Task.Delay to Thread.Sleep

* Update package_push_github.yml

* chore: update library package and filter the local failure message just executed

* chore: update library package

* Update package_push_github.yml

* Update package_push_github.yml

* chore: ILogger changed to optional

* chore: add Logging by integrationEventBus

* chore: Handle background local message tasks

* refactor: Handling null exceptions, warnings, and Logger changed to not requiredHandling null exceptions, warnings, and Logger changed to not required

* chore: update library package

* chore: adjust DelayAsync

* chore: Replacement interval in seconds

* chore: delete summodule

* chore: add MASA.BuildingBlocks submodules

* chore: Change parameter remarks

* chore: Adjust package references

* chore: remove MASA.BuildingBlock package

* Update package_push_nuget.org.yml

Co-authored-by: zhenlei520 <[email protected]>
Co-authored-by: zhenlei520 <[email protected]>
Co-authored-by: 朱嵘 <[email protected]>
Co-authored-by: capdiem <[email protected]>
Co-authored-by: 曹尤先 <[email protected]>
Co-authored-by: zhenlei520 <[email protected]>
Co-authored-by: 王达 <[email protected]>
Co-authored-by: PollosD <[email protected]>

* Update package_push_nuget.org.yml

* Update package_push_nuget.org.yml

* chore: delete submodule

* chore: add submodule

* refactor: change MASA.Contrib to Masa.Contrib

* refactor: change MASA.Contrib to Masa.Contrib

* chore: update readme

* chore: change readme

* chore: change readme

Co-authored-by: 鬼谷子 <[email protected]>
Co-authored-by: zhenlei520 <[email protected]>
Co-authored-by: zhenlei520 <[email protected]>
Co-authored-by: 朱嵘 <[email protected]>
Co-authored-by: capdiem <[email protected]>
Co-authored-by: 曹尤先 <[email protected]>
Co-authored-by: 王达 <[email protected]>
Co-authored-by: PollosD <[email protected]>

* chore: update submodule

* chore: update git workflow

Co-authored-by: zhenlei520 <[email protected]>
Co-authored-by: zhenlei520 <[email protected]>
Co-authored-by: 朱嵘 <[email protected]>
Co-authored-by: capdiem <[email protected]>
Co-authored-by: 曹尤先 <[email protected]>
Co-authored-by: zhenlei520 <[email protected]>
Co-authored-by: 王达 <[email protected]>
Co-authored-by: PollosD <[email protected]>